Outgoings:
Council Rates: $3,460 approx. per annum
Water Rates: $820.95 approx. per annum
Rental Returns:
Front home 2 Blackley Avenue: $550 approx. per week
Back granny - 2A Blackley Avenue: $510 approx. per week
Total Rental Return: $1,060 approx. per week
